Simplifying -16t2 + 580t = 0 Reorder the terms: 580t + -16t2 = 0 Solving 580t + -16t2 = 0 Solving for variable 't'.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'4t'. 4t(145 + -4t) = 0 Ignore the factor 4.Subproblem 1
Set the factor 't'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ying t = 0 Solving t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ying t = 0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(145 + -4t)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 145 + -4t = 0 Solving 145 + -4t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-145' to each side of the equation. 145 + -145 + -4t = 0 + -145 Combine like terms: 145 + -145 = 0 0 + -4t = 0 + -145 -4t = 0 + -145 Combine like terms: 0 + -145 = -145 -4t = -145 Divide each side by '-4'. t = 36.25 Simplifying t = 36.25Solution
t = {0, 36.25}
